The B1 language certificate is a widely acknowledged benchmark for intermediate language efficiency, based upon the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). The CEFR is a structure utilized to assess and classify language skills on a six-level scale: A1, A2, B1, B2, C1, and öSd Grundstufe C2.

A1 and B1 Zertifikat Deutsch A2: Beginner levels
B1 and B2: Intermediate levels
C1 and C2: Advanced levels
At the B1 (intermediate) level, individuals are anticipated to have the interaction abilities needed for Deutsch Zertifikat daily conversations, job-related jobs, and standard travel experiences. The certificate confirms that the learner can:

Understand and produce easy, linked texts.
Engage successfully in discussions about familiar topics.
Convey previous experiences, öSd Grundstufe future strategies, and opinions plainly.
Who Needs a Language Certificate at the B1 Level?
A B1 language certification can be helpful in a variety of contexts:

Study-related Requirements:

Lots of universities and colleges, particularly in non-English-speaking countries, need students to show a B1 language level to enroll in specific programs, particularly exchange programs.
Job-related Opportunities:

Employers typically look for candidates with an intermediate level of language ability for roles requiring basic communication with global clients, associates, or suppliers.
Immigration and Citizenship:

Some countries require a B1 language certification as part of their migration or citizenship processes, showing candidates can integrate into the community.
Personal Development:

Anybody aiming to improve their confidence and skills when traveling or engaging with a global community can take advantage of earning this certificate.
What Does the B1 Level Involve?
The B1 level focuses on practical, practical language abilities rather than complex grammatical complexity. Candidates are normally examined in 4 areas of language competency:

1. Reading
Understand straightforward, b1 zertifikat deutsch everyday texts (newspapers, e-mails, advertisements).
Understand the meaning of general or foreseeable details.
2. Writing
Compose simple essays, letters, or keeps in mind about familiar topics.
Express opinions, offer explanations, and describe experiences with coherence.
3. Listening
Comprehend discussions on regular matters (work, leisure, family topics).
Follow the main ideas in speeches, presentations, or short news reports.
4. Speaking
Engage in basic conversations, actively and appropriately responding to questions.
Tell individual experiences or discuss routine jobs.
How to Prepare for the B1 Language Exam
Achieving success in the B1 level exam requires consistent effort and a structured research study technique. Here are some actionable preparation suggestions:

1. Acquaint Yourself with the Exam Format
Each exam supplier (e.g., IELTS, TOEFL, Goethe-Institut, DELF) follows slightly various formats for the B1 test. Study previous papers or sample questions to understand the style and structure of the exam.
2. Focus on Vocabulary and Grammar
Find out vocabulary related to common topics like family, travel, pastimes, and work.
Modify intermediate-level grammar, such as verb tenses, modal verbs, and conditionals.
3. Practice the Four Core Areas
Checking out: Read newspapers, publication posts, or narratives in your target language.
Composing: Practice writing e-mails, essays, or letters on everyday subjects.
Listening: Watch TV shows, listen to audiobooks, and follow podcasts.
Speaking: Join language groups, practice with native speakers, or record yourself.
4. Enroll in a Course or Use Reliable Resources
Consider enrolling in a B1 preparation course offered by reputable institutions.
Usage apps, online platforms, and textbooks designed for your target language.
5. Take Practice Tests
Mimic exam conditions to develop self-confidence and enhance time management skills.

FAQs: Language Certificate B1
1. What is the distinction between B1 and B2 levels?
B1 represents intermediate efficiency, where students can handle familiar subjects and basic interaction.
ÖSD-Zertifikat B2 shows upper-intermediate skills, such as disputing complex topics and understanding specialized texts.
2. Which exam providers use B1 level accreditations?
Common suppliers include IELTS, TOEFL, Cambridge English, Goethe-Institut (German), DELF (French), and DELE (Spanish).
3. The length of time does it take to get ready for the B1 exam?
Preparation time varies depending upon previous knowledge and available resources. Typically, prospects who are novices require 350-400 hours of research study to reach the B1 level.
4. What is the credibility of the B1 language certificate?
The credibility depends on the exam service provider. For example, IELTS certificates stand for 2 years, while others like Cambridge English exams may not expire.
5. Can I take the B1 language exam online?
Many providers use online or computer-based exams, but talk to your picked company for availability.
